    Indigo Wild Explores the Wild Side of Natural Skincare

    Fun, health, and perkily irreverent Indigo Wild style go together like peanut butter and jelly. Just about the only thing the company takes completely seriously is creating top-quality, health-boosting bar soaps, skin care, natural home products, and aromatherapy solutions. They’ll accept no substitutes for pure, clean, fresh natural ingredients. Some products contain goat’s milk, such as the original Zum Bar that helped the company make a name for itself. Since goat’s milk is full of vitamins, minerals, and triglycerides, it provides a nourishing touch to the skin. Though some products utilize goat’s milk, many of Indigo Wild’s products are vegan and free of animal byproducts.

    Natural, Food-Grade Ingredients Are Indigo Wild’s Wholesome Skincare Secret

    Whether it’s a facial scrub or clean laundry soap made from baking soda, coconut oil, and essential oils, Indigo Wild uses only the purest natural ingredients. Every formula is kept as simple as possible so there’s no room for chemicals, fillers, and other nasty stuff to creep in. Lots and lots of their ingredients are certified organic, whether it’s beeswax, grapeseed oil, honey, shea butter, or sunflower oil. The rest are pretty much all 100% food grade and often natural, too. Their philosophy is straightforward when it comes to skin care products – don’t include anything you wouldn’t want to put on your skin.

    How Indigo Wild Keeps Abreast of Mammary Health and Animal Welfare

    Indigo Wild says that they’ve got two things they’re especially passionate about (in addition to great health and positive feelings) – boobs and pooches. Their mammary mission is to support cancer warriors with donations to Turning Point: the Center for Hope and Healing. This foundation helps support a positive and healthy lifestyle for breast cancer survivors. Regarding dogs, Indigo Wild’s full of rescue dog adoptees, who share the space with the business every day in their own comfy pooch run. Charity doesn’t end at home – the company also donates to the Kansas City Sheltie Rescue.
